Output d66eded90b4c218ccd15959a1741ee152091a8dab98ee908b73a4b3f2544f1aa:2

value
280187787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ae2f5c91b213c60a2bbe7cccebbd1d7aedb25e22 OP_EQUAL
address
3Ha2EfTCLNaP9JFtefWcJFJ8TTadcvKTnz
transaction
d66eded90b4c218ccd15959a1741ee152091a8dab98ee908b73a4b3f2544f1aa
spent
true